Browse code

lavfi/vf_thumbnail: remove looping on request_frame().

Nicolas George authored on 2015/10/02 23:19:55
Showing 1 changed files
... ...
@@ -172,9 +172,7 @@ static int request_frame(AVFilterLink *link)
172 172
     AVFilterContext *ctx = link->src;
173 173
     ThumbContext *s = ctx->priv;
174 174
 
175
-    /* loop until a frame thumbnail is available (when a frame is queued,
176
-     * s->n is reset to zero) */
177
-    do {
175
+    /* TODO reindent */
178 176
         int ret = ff_request_frame(ctx->inputs[0]);
179 177
         if (ret == AVERROR_EOF && s->n) {
180 178
             ret = ff_filter_frame(link, get_best_frame(ctx));
... ...
@@ -184,7 +182,6 @@ static int request_frame(AVFilterLink *link)
184 184
         }
185 185
         if (ret < 0)
186 186
             return ret;
187
-    } while (s->n);
188 187
     return 0;
189 188
 }
190 189